BASIC FUNCTION:
The Corporate Operations Specialist is responsible for processing and servicing a wide variety of loans including highly complex mortgage and commercial loans, loan servicing actions, syndications and/or participations to expedite credit delivery in the Corporate Banking Group; answering involved inquiries and resolving challenging problems. Ensures that loan documentation meets all regulatory and legal requirements. Is a member of and provides support to customer deal teams. Leads and directs deal teams with respect to regulatory and documentation needs for complex loan transactions. Works closely with customers, deal teams, multiple AAC departments, syndicate and/or participant lending partners, attorneys and/or title companies to seamlessly provide timely credit to customers and an overall positive experience for customers and employees. Assists with the loan boarding process into accounting systems.
The Corporate Operations Specialist may or may not manage a portfolio with an emphasis in a particular area, either Agribusiness, Capital Markets Originated, or Capital Markets Non-Originated. While the basic job function remains the same, the degree in which tasks are required and completed depend on the Association's role in the transaction.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ES:
- Participate in deal calls to gain an understanding of documentation and structuring needs both from an Association and borrower perspective. Direct deal team to obtain necessary information and assist with same as appropriate.
- Determine appropriate title insurance requirements are requested and accurate loan documentation is prepared to cover the Association when dealing with cross collateralization of complex real estate transactions, such as multiple title policies with tie-in endorsements and prorating title insurance coverage to cover multiple loans based on multiple collateral values.
- Request, review, process and provide instruction to others with respect to entity documents, loan documents, title due diligence, appraisals, insurance information, environmental compliance, lien perfection, deposit account set up, disbursements, UCC filing/monitoring, etc.
- Apply independent discretion and knowledge to answer questions from deal teams, title companies, customers, attorneys, other departments and syndicate/participant lending partners. Keep all groups informed as to loan status and readiness for closing. Proactively reach out to various individuals to hold them accountable to their responsibilities to ensure a timely and accurate loan closing and funding.
- Receive, analyze, investigate and track loan information. Recognize discrepancies and/or noncompliance with policies and procedures, and respond appropriately; request clarification and supporting documentation from deal teams, lenders, attorneys, title companies or borrowers as needed. Ensure all loan controls and closing conditions for the approved loan transaction are reflected in the final loan documents and obtained prior to closing the loan.
- Create, review and monitor covenants and covenant reports in compliance with Association procedures. Keep deal teams informed of updates, compliance with covenant monitoring, loan servicing, insurance requirements, etc.
- Establish and maintain accurate member files to ensure documentation is complete, supports the credit, is compliant with policies, procedures and regulations. Manage distribution of information to staff and other lenders or partners as appropriate.
- Review trust certifications and entity documentation to verify authority and accuracy of signers, which may involve multiple and various types of entities, ensure that the loan origination system is completed consistently with this information; request/review searches of same.
- Review and analyze appraisal reports to determine the collateral valued for the transaction, owners of collateral and ensure that the loan origination system accurately reflects all of this information and appropriate insurance coverage is required, obtained, and maintained. Review the necessary security documentation needed to perfect American AgCredit's lien on real property held as fee simple and/or leasehold estate as well as associated personal property, such as water assets, equipment, timber, fixtures, etc. Request clarification and supporting documentation as needed from the deal team, documentation team, appraisers, attorneys, customers, lenders and/or title companies as needed.
- Review personal property and real property searches, preliminary title/commitment reports and copies of other lien filings to identify and confirm that American AgCredit's lien position meets approved requirements. Review subordination and other documents necessary to perfect American AgCredit's lien on collateral. Identify and address any potential closing issues and appropriate documentation required for closing.
- Review escrow instructions for real property secured transactions, confirming appropriate level of coverage is required with necessary title endorsements.
- Process requests for partial releases, exchanges, additions, leases, easements and monetary transactions.
- Review nonstandard language for loan documents as required. Coordinate with legal counsel to develop and prepare loan documentation or provide non standard language when necessary.
- Prepare Participation Certificates and related documentation. Review Participation Certificates prepared by others to ensure they accurately reflect the details and negotiated terms of the participation.
- Review, understand and extract data from complex loan agreements and loan origination system to assist the Accounting Department in accurately booking loans in the loan accounting systems and provide timely funding to customers and lending partners.
- Compose and prepare correspondence; prepare, edit and proof various loan related documents. Instruct deal team to create appropriate loan conditions and covenants and ensure compliance with same.
- Input required data into loan origination and related systems.
- Answer inquiries and provide information to deal teams, lenders and others as to perfecting loan collateral, loan structure, loan covenants and conditions and/or direct other inquiries to the appropriate person. Initiate deal team calls including representatives from ancillary departments to ensure alignment on deal structure, outstanding deliverables, timing and ability to meet target closing date.
- Identify and provide details of deficiencies in loan documentation information and packages to gain more efficiency and provide better customer service.
- Review loan documentation prepared by self, peers, LDD, counsel, or other lenders for accuracy and completion, as well as to identify and track pre and post closing requirements including ongoing covenant monitoring, and ensure loan origination system reflects consistent information.
- Prepare certain loan documentation including but not limited to Interest Rate Disclosure Statements, Renewal Letters, Extension Letters, Membership Agreements and Conversion documentation.
- Research and analyze loan packages to independently prepare loan documentation according to loan request and approval for Agribusiness loans and servicing actions.
- Identify, recommend and assist in the implementation of process improvements and procedure changes. Represent Corporate Banking on special projects and research as assigned.
- Coordinate loan closings with lenders, customers, title companies, attorneys and other departments.
- Maintain relationships and provide excellent service to borrowers as well as other AAC employees and external partners such as lenders, participants, attorneys, title companies and vendors.
- Utilize data to manage workload and monitor accuracy of information.
- Assist as appropriate with mortgage lien certifications, covenant monitoring, paid off loans and other processes.
- Perform other functions as assigned.
